Treatment time

After your lip filler procedure, your lips will have a swelling phase. It will go away after a few days, but the results are temporary. Your lips may look uneven for a few weeks. It is best to avoid massaging your lips immediately after the procedure, as this increases the risk of injecting filler into areas where it is not intended. The full effect of your treatment should become apparent three to five days after your procedure.

Bruising is common following your procedure, and you should apply ice or take an arnica tablet to minimize the swelling. You should avoid vigorous physical activity for 24 hours after the procedure to reduce the risk of swelling. Swelling usually subsides within a day or two, but may persist for a week. Avoid rubbing the area after your treatment for the first 24 hours. If the swelling lasts longer than that, you should consult with your doctor.

Cost

If you want to improve the appearance of your lips, you might consider using a lip filler. The procedure can make your lips look fuller and more even in shape. Depending on the type of filler used, it can cost anywhere from $250 to $500 per syringe also the lip filler cost in Mumbai will be same. Generally, a half-syringe will give you results, but the fuller you want, the higher the price. And you should know that the procedure can cause some side effects.

You can also go for a combination procedure that includes both hyaluronidase and lip filler. This will cost anywhere from five hundred to a thousand dollars, depending on the type of filler. It may be necessary to repeat the procedure if the results are substantial. Also, you need to wait about two weeks before having more filler applied. Generally, hyaluronic acid lip fillers are the most affordable option.

Where to get it

Finding a good place to have a lip filler procedure can be like finding a gas station when your tank is empty. You want to make sure you go to a facility that has a board-certified physician, uses FDA-approved filler, and has before and after pictures. Make sure to tell the provider your health history and ask about any risks associated with the procedure. Lastly, make sure to ask about the cost. Fortunately, lip filler is a relatively inexpensive procedure if you use a qualified provider.
